If I create shortcut which links to "MyExe.exe / RegServer" then right-click
and select Run as Administrator then the program runs and registers as
normal. So the registration will succeed if the program is launched as
elevated. However, I can't figure out how to do this from my MSI and I don't
understand why it's not happening naturally, since hte MSI itself is already
running elevated.
